There is a significant gap in the cost of living between these two cities. Huntington is 20.5% cheaper than Jeffersonville. With a cost index of 66 vs 83, the difference would have a meaningful impact on a household's monthly budget. Someone relocating from Huntington to Jeffersonville should plan for substantially higher expenses across most categories.

On the housing front, median rent in Huntington is $852/month compared to $1,090/month in Jeffersonville — a 22%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Huntington is more affordable at $104,300 median vs $208,500.

Median household income in Huntington is $51,220 compared to $70,157 in Jeffersonville (-27%). While Jeffersonville is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Huntington spend roughly 20% of their income on rent, more than the 18.6% in Jeffersonville.
